HJR 4, 70th R.S.
Proposing a constitutional amendment authorizing the legislature to provide for the issuance of bonds and state financing of development and production of Texas products and businesses.

Last action: Filed with the Secretary of State

Author: Paul Colbert
Sponsor: Bob Glasgow

Remarks: Referred to subcommittee on Economic Development. Enabling legislation is HB 5, 70R; HB 1183, 70R (vetoed); and HB 49, 70(2). To be voted on November 3, 1987.

Session Law Chapter: Acts 1987, 70th R.S., HJR 4
